The Teacher as Builder of Values

THEORY
- Understand the ethical framework for building professional relationships
- Develop an appreciation and tolerance for diversity through a Christian Liberal Arts education
- Recognize the impact of family involvement in student learning
PEDAGOGY
- Recognize the needs for inclusive instruction that matches individual abilities with teaching strategies
- Develop skills in using technologies that crate learning opportunities for all students
- Establish high expectations for all learners
PRACTICE
- Use ongoing, multiple assessment strategies to modify instruction
- Create safe and supportive classroom environments
- Demonstrate an ability and willingness to evaluate professional performance and develop strategies that promote continuous improvement
- Participate in the Master the Art of Living Program which promotes the opportunity to grow in discipline, service, and faith
- Models professional behaviors, values, and dispositions
RESEARCH
- Commit to using research-based practices in developing curriculum and instruction
- Use research to promote lifelong learning
